Description
Crispy and spicy buffalo cauliflower bites made in the air fryer. A healthier alternative to traditional wings, perfect for snacks or appetizers.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 medium head cauliflower, cut into florets
- 1/2 cup hot sauce
- 2 tbsp melted butter or olive oil
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our or gluten-free flour
- 1/4 cup water
Instructions
- Preheat air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
- In a bowl, mix flour, water, garlic powder, paprika, and salt to form a batter.
- Toss cauliflower florets in the batter until coated.
- Place coated cauliflower in the air fryer basket in a single layer.
- Cook for 12-15 minutes, shaking halfway, until crispy.
- In a separate bowl, mix hot sauce and melted butter.
- Toss cooked cauliflower in the buffalo sauce.
- Return to the air fryer for 2-3 minutes to crisp further.
- Serve immediately with ranch or blue cheese dressing.
Notes
- For extra crispiness, lightly spray cauliflower with cooking oil before air frying.
- Adjust hot sauce quantity based on your spice preference.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
